#### An overview of this role
As a Senior Manager, Revenue Accounting, you’ll help GitLab scale and strengthen the processes behind revenue recognition and deferred commissions accounting. This is an individual contributor role reporting to the Director of Revenue Accounting, with broad influence across Finance, Product, Deal Desk, Legal, Information Technology, Sales Operations, and Financial Planning and Analysis. You’ll lead process improvements, system automation, and team enablement across quote-to-cash workflows, helping the team improve accuracy, support compliance, and prepare for new products, services, and pricing models.
This role is a strong fit if you enjoy combining technical accounting depth with operational problem-solving. You’ll evaluate the revenue impact of new offerings before launch, improve how systems and teams work together, and help build scalable processes that support timely financial reporting and audit readiness. In your first year, you’ll focus on improving workflows, strengthening adoption of new tools and processes, and helping the revenue accounting function operate with more consistency and efficiency.
